description
Hertfordshire County Council is currently out to procurement for the Provision of Property Management Services
The Council is seeking to work with a Contractor who will lead in the property management of the Estate and the delivery of the Council's strategic direction for the Estate. The Contractor will provide strategic and day to day advice to the Council in its ongoing stewardship of the Estate and will self-commission core services in the delivery of this direction within the parameters of the specified services and fixed prices.

Tenderers should be aware that due to the nature of the Services provided, any Contract formed as a result of this procurement process shall be executed as a deed. Tenderers should seek independent legal advice on the implications of this prior to submitting their Tender, where appropriate.
The use of Lots has been considered for this procurement, but have not been used, because the Council is looking to make cost savings and drive efficiencies through the use of one main contractor who will have knowledge of the full estates and asset management functions.
